Building raising services involve elevating existing structures to address various structural or environmental challenges. Typically, these services include lifting a building from its foundation and placing it on a new, higher support system. This process often requires careful planning and precise execution to ensure the stability and integrity of the property during and after the lift. Building raising is a specialized procedure that helps adapt properties to changing conditions or to meet local building requirements.

One of the primary problems that building raising services help solve is flooding or water damage. Properties located in flood-prone areas can be elevated to reduce the risk of water intrusion during heavy rains or rising water levels. Additionally, building raising can be used to comply with local zoning laws or to prevent damage caused by shifting ground or unstable foundations. It is also a solution for properties that need to be preserved or adapted for new uses without the expense of complete reconstruction.

The types of properties that typically utilize building raising services include residential homes, especially those in flood zones or areas with unstable soil. Commercial buildings, such as retail spaces or offices, may also be raised to meet regulatory requirements or to protect assets from flood risks. In some cases, historic structures are elevated to preserve their character while ensuring they remain functional and safe in changing environmental conditions.

Cost Range - Building raising services typically cost between $3,000 and $12,000 per structure, depending on size and complexity. For example, raising a small home might be around $4,500, while larger buildings can approach $10,000 or more.

Factors Influencing Costs - Expenses vary based on the foundation type, height of raising, and local labor rates. Additional costs may include permits, which can add several hundred to a few thousand dollars.

Average Project Expenses - On average, homeowners in Midlothian, IL, can expect to spend approximately $5,000 to $8,000 for standard building raising projects. Larger or more intricate structures tend to be at the higher end of this range.
